Call Us: 310.595.4554

Thank
You

Thank You

Thank you for reaching out to Self Image Studio. We will be in touch within 24 hours or less to discuss your inquiry. We look forward to speaking with you soon.

In the meantime, please feel free to follow Self Image Studio on our social media accounts below:

Contact Info

Phone No.

310.595.4554

Office Address

5230 Carroll Canyon Road Suite 100
San Diego, CA 92121